Hey everyone! Quick update, a couple of people have mentioned the app line learner working great too. I’ve used it since posting this video and it does work well, only thing is, I didn’t find it super user friendly and you can’t change the pitch of the readers lines like you can on audacity, so it’s obvious it’s a recording of yourself. However, I’ve booked jobs from using line learner so it doesn’t seem to matter too much. Thought I’d mention that incase anyone wants another solution ☺️

This is great! My only add on would be that once you can afford to, buy a decent mic to record the lines, similar to what you would buy if you were interested in doing voiceover work. (It doesn't have to be expensive, my lovely Sudotack was 35 quid second hand.) The mic will help to reduce room noise and/or make it easier to remove room noise in editing, so you don't hear it in between the silenced moments giving away the fact that you are responding to a recording.

Often on youtube when people show self-tapes the reader's voice is barely possible to hear (on the cell phone at least), if without a speaker, what can be a solution to that? Also the condenser mics (like the one you showed in your other self tape tutorial) usually work better if you are very close to the mic. I wonder what affordable equipment one can use in such case to make the sound recording louder? Apart from boosting it in post production
@SeverineHowellMeri
@SeverineHowellMeri Год назад
Boosting it in post production can help but in my experience, it doesn’t matter if the readers voice can be heard too loudly since it isn’t their tape, it’s yours. So long as you can hear it when you’re recording it and it’s a little audible in the final thing, you should be good to go. If you’re recording the readers lines yourself, make sure you’re close to the mic when you do so and you can try boosting the gain. Usually, recording it in your phone and then airdropping it to your laptop to edit it in audacity will make it clear enough.
